About This Vintage 1958 Edition

Thor Heyerdahl's "Aku-Aku," published by Rand McNally & Company in 1958, is a fascinating exploration of Easter Island's mysteries. This American Edition provides insight into Heyerdahl's groundbreaking research and theories about the island's enigmatic statues and ancient civilization. The book was first published in Norwegian in 1957, with the English edition released in London by George Allen & Unwin Ltd. in 1958. This particular printing by Rand McNally showcases Heyerdahl's expertise as a renowned explorer and anthropologist. The book's subject matter delves into anthropology and archaeology, making it a significant contribution to the understanding of Polynesian culture and history.
